Eating habits to prevent heart disease

1, reduce meat

Dr Jeffrey Flem, a registered dietitian and professor of nutrition at Murray State University, said that the most important thing in a heart disease diet is to reduce meat intake. Animal food and saturated fat are always inseparable. Patients with heart disease should try to eat less meat (especially fat) food and high-fat and high-cholesterol food such as animal viscera.

Excessive fat intake can easily lead to obesity, hyperlipidemia and arteriosclerosis. Excessive cholesterol intake will increase coronary heart disease, fatty liver and hyperlipidemia. Suggestion: eat less high-fat foods such as fat, cream and butter, and eat less high-cholesterol foods such as animal liver, brain and roe; Eating more beans, lecithin and inorganic salts rich in soybeans are helpful to prevent and treat coronary heart disease.

Step 2 limit harmful fats

Dr Melissa Olson, head of the heart disease prevention and rehabilitation program at Cleveland Clinic in the United States, said that patients with heart disease should read food labels carefully before buying food. If a serving of saturated fat exceeds 2 grams, it will be harmful to heart health.

In addition, foods with trans fats exceeding 1g per 100 calories should be avoided. Many packaged snacks are not up to standard, including baked snacks, biscuits and potato chips.
